Default What are \"first-time deposit bonuses\" connected to?

Just a quick question. When we make a first-time deposit to take advantage of a bonus, is that "first-time" connected to:

a) our account info (name and addy)
b) credit card number
c) something else

Basically I previously started an UB account under my name but with my Mum's CC (I didn't have one at the time). So if I start a new UB account under my name with my credit card will this work?

I presume you can't just start a new account with the same name and CC number and get another "first-time" bonus?!

UB let's you have 3 accounts. The bonus is less then $1 an hour at any limit though so I don't know what you would really gain by it. If you are doing it for rakeback it probably won't work as you will most likely be tied to your original signup method.
